AI Model Evaluation In Blockchain
Explore diverse perspectives on AI Model Evaluation with structured content covering metrics, tools, challenges, and future trends for actionable insights.
In the rapidly evolving world of blockchain technology, artificial intelligence (AI) has emerged as a transformative force, driving innovation and efficiency across industries. However, the integration of AI into blockchain systems is not without its challenges. One of the most critical aspects of this integration is the evaluation of AI models within blockchain environments. This process ensures that AI models are not only accurate and efficient but also secure, scalable, and aligned with the decentralized ethos of blockchain.
This comprehensive guide delves into the intricacies of AI model evaluation in blockchain, offering actionable insights, proven strategies, and practical applications for professionals. Whether you're a blockchain developer, data scientist, or business leader, this guide will equip you with the knowledge and tools needed to navigate this complex yet rewarding domain. From understanding the basics to exploring future trends, this article covers every facet of AI model evaluation in blockchain, ensuring you're well-prepared to leverage this powerful synergy for success.
Accelerate [AI Model Evaluation] processes for agile teams with streamlined workflows.
Understanding the basics of ai model evaluation in blockchain
What is AI Model Evaluation in Blockchain?
AI model evaluation in blockchain refers to the systematic process of assessing the performance, reliability, and security of AI models deployed within blockchain ecosystems. This evaluation ensures that the AI models meet predefined criteria, such as accuracy, efficiency, scalability, and compliance with blockchain's decentralized principles. Unlike traditional AI evaluation, this process must account for the unique characteristics of blockchain, such as immutability, transparency, and distributed architecture.
For instance, in a blockchain-based supply chain system, an AI model predicting demand must be evaluated not only for its predictive accuracy but also for its ability to operate seamlessly within a decentralized network. This involves testing the model's compatibility with smart contracts, its computational efficiency on blockchain nodes, and its resilience against potential security threats.
Key Components of AI Model Evaluation in Blockchain
-
Performance Metrics: These include accuracy, precision, recall, and F1 score, which measure the AI model's effectiveness in making predictions or classifications. In blockchain, additional metrics like latency and throughput are also critical.
-
Security Assessment: Given the decentralized nature of blockchain, AI models must be evaluated for vulnerabilities to attacks, such as adversarial inputs or data poisoning.
-
Scalability Testing: Blockchain networks often involve numerous nodes. The AI model must be tested for its ability to scale without compromising performance.
-
Interoperability: The model's compatibility with blockchain protocols, smart contracts, and other decentralized applications (dApps) is crucial.
-
Ethical and Compliance Checks: Ensuring that the AI model adheres to ethical guidelines and regulatory requirements, particularly in sensitive applications like finance or healthcare.
Importance of ai model evaluation in modern applications
Benefits of AI Model Evaluation for Businesses
-
Enhanced Decision-Making: Accurate and reliable AI models enable businesses to make data-driven decisions, improving efficiency and outcomes.
-
Increased Security: Rigorous evaluation helps identify and mitigate vulnerabilities, protecting blockchain systems from potential threats.
-
Regulatory Compliance: Proper evaluation ensures that AI models meet legal and ethical standards, reducing the risk of penalties or reputational damage.
-
Optimized Resource Utilization: By identifying inefficiencies, businesses can optimize the deployment of AI models, saving time and resources.
-
Improved User Trust: Transparent and well-evaluated AI models foster trust among users, a critical factor in blockchain's decentralized ecosystems.
Real-World Examples of AI Model Evaluation in Blockchain
-
Decentralized Finance (DeFi): In DeFi platforms, AI models are used for risk assessment and fraud detection. Evaluating these models ensures they provide accurate insights while maintaining the security of financial transactions.
-
Healthcare Data Management: Blockchain-based healthcare systems use AI for patient data analysis. Evaluation ensures that these models are both accurate and compliant with data privacy regulations.
-
Supply Chain Optimization: AI models in blockchain-based supply chains predict demand and optimize logistics. Evaluation ensures these models operate efficiently within decentralized networks.
Related:
Organizational Alignment On PMFClick here to utilize our free project management templates!
Proven techniques for effective ai model evaluation in blockchain
Step-by-Step Guide to AI Model Evaluation in Blockchain
-
Define Evaluation Criteria: Establish clear metrics and benchmarks based on the application's requirements.
-
Data Preparation: Ensure the training and testing datasets are representative, unbiased, and compatible with blockchain's data structure.
-
Model Testing: Use techniques like cross-validation and A/B testing to assess the model's performance.
-
Security Analysis: Conduct penetration testing and adversarial attack simulations to identify vulnerabilities.
-
Scalability Assessment: Test the model's performance across different blockchain nodes and network conditions.
-
Interoperability Testing: Verify the model's compatibility with blockchain protocols and smart contracts.
-
Ethical Review: Evaluate the model for compliance with ethical guidelines and regulatory standards.
-
Continuous Monitoring: Implement mechanisms for ongoing evaluation and updates to address evolving challenges.
Common Mistakes to Avoid in AI Model Evaluation
-
Neglecting Security: Overlooking security assessments can leave the system vulnerable to attacks.
-
Ignoring Scalability: Failing to test for scalability can lead to performance bottlenecks in larger networks.
-
Using Biased Data: Training models on biased datasets can result in inaccurate or unfair outcomes.
-
Overfitting: Over-optimizing the model for training data can reduce its effectiveness in real-world scenarios.
-
Lack of Documentation: Inadequate documentation can hinder future evaluations and updates.
Tools and frameworks for ai model evaluation in blockchain
Top Tools for AI Model Evaluation
-
TensorFlow and PyTorch: Popular frameworks for building and evaluating AI models, offering extensive libraries and tools.
-
Hyperledger Fabric: A blockchain platform that supports AI model integration and evaluation.
-
OpenAI Gym: Useful for testing reinforcement learning models in blockchain applications.
-
Blockchain Testnets: Platforms like Ethereum's Ropsten or Binance Smart Chain Testnet allow for safe testing of AI models in blockchain environments.
-
Security Tools: Tools like Metasploit and OWASP ZAP for identifying vulnerabilities in AI models.
How to Choose the Right Framework for AI Model Evaluation
-
Compatibility: Ensure the framework supports the blockchain platform in use.
-
Scalability: Choose a framework that can handle the scale of your application.
-
Ease of Use: Opt for frameworks with user-friendly interfaces and extensive documentation.
-
Community Support: A strong community can provide valuable resources and troubleshooting assistance.
-
Cost: Consider the cost of the framework, especially for large-scale applications.
Related:
Organizational Alignment On PMFClick here to utilize our free project management templates!
Challenges and solutions in ai model evaluation in blockchain
Overcoming Common Obstacles in AI Model Evaluation
-
Data Privacy: Use techniques like federated learning to train models without compromising data privacy.
-
Computational Constraints: Optimize models for efficiency to operate within blockchain's resource limitations.
-
Regulatory Compliance: Stay updated on regulations and incorporate compliance checks into the evaluation process.
-
Interoperability Issues: Use standardized protocols and APIs to ensure compatibility.
-
Security Threats: Regularly update models and conduct security audits to mitigate risks.
Best Practices for Long-Term Success in AI Model Evaluation
-
Adopt a Holistic Approach: Consider all aspects, including performance, security, and compliance.
-
Invest in Training: Equip your team with the skills needed for effective evaluation.
-
Leverage Automation: Use automated tools for continuous monitoring and evaluation.
-
Foster Collaboration: Encourage collaboration between AI and blockchain teams for better integration.
-
Stay Agile: Be prepared to adapt to new challenges and advancements in technology.
Future trends in ai model evaluation in blockchain
Emerging Innovations in AI Model Evaluation
-
Federated Learning: Decentralized training methods that align with blockchain's principles.
-
Explainable AI (XAI): Tools and techniques for making AI models more transparent and interpretable.
-
Quantum Computing: Potential to revolutionize AI model evaluation with unprecedented computational power.
Predictions for the Next Decade of AI Model Evaluation
-
Increased Automation: Greater reliance on automated tools for real-time evaluation.
-
Stronger Regulations: Stricter compliance requirements, particularly in sensitive industries.
-
Integration with IoT: AI models in blockchain will increasingly interact with IoT devices, necessitating new evaluation criteria.
-
Focus on Sustainability: Emphasis on energy-efficient models to align with global sustainability goals.
Related:
Organizational Alignment On PMFClick here to utilize our free project management templates!
Faqs
What are the key metrics for AI model evaluation in blockchain?
Key metrics include accuracy, precision, recall, F1 score, latency, throughput, scalability, and security.
How can I improve AI model evaluation in my organization?
Invest in training, adopt automated tools, and establish clear evaluation criteria tailored to your application.
What are the risks associated with AI model evaluation in blockchain?
Risks include data privacy breaches, security vulnerabilities, and non-compliance with regulations.
Which industries benefit the most from AI model evaluation in blockchain?
Industries like finance, healthcare, supply chain, and energy stand to gain significantly from effective evaluation.
How do I get started with AI model evaluation in blockchain?
Begin by defining your evaluation criteria, selecting the right tools, and assembling a skilled team for the task.
Accelerate [AI Model Evaluation] processes for agile teams with streamlined workflows.